What is Mr Jeff - On-Demand Laundry?
Mr Jeff is a lifestyle app providing on-demand laundry, dry cleaning, and specialized item restoration for urban residents on iOS and Android.
Users hire Mr Jeff to outsource recurring garment care and specialized cleaning, trading the time cost of laundry for a subscription-based pickup and delivery service.

What Are The Key Features?
Monthly home delivery plans for recurring laundry and ironing
Doorstep collection and return service with scheduled windows
Cleaning and restoration for sneakers, caps, and helmets
How much does it cost?
- One-off order service
- Monthly subscription plans
Hybrid model combining transactional one-off revenue with recurring subscription plans to stabilize logistics utilization.

Head to Head
Mr Jeff should double down on its subscription value proposition and personalized service to differentiate from Tide’s commoditized, kiosk-heavy approach.
What sets Mr Jeff - On-Demand Laundry apart
Mr Jeff offers a more focused subscription-based model that encourages recurring monthly revenue and customer loyalty.
The platform is built specifically for a digital-first pickup and delivery experience, potentially offering a leaner UX.
What's Tide Cleaners | Dry Cleaning's Edge
Tide’s 24-hour kiosk network removes the dependency on specific delivery windows, solving the biggest friction point in laundry.
Significant scale and brand recognition provide a massive acquisition advantage that smaller, niche laundry apps cannot match.
